About The Position

Summary: The Human Resource Generalist will assist with all aspects of Human Resources administration, including employee relations matters, compensation and benefits, recruitment, staffing and plant communications. Requirements

  • Post secondary education in business, human resources or related field or equivalent experience.
  • Three years experience in human resources field, preferably in a manufacturing environment
  • Able to work well with others; build and maintain positive employee relations
  • Able to prepare, read and interpret written reports, business correspondence, instructions, procedures and guidelines
  • Excellent oral and written communications and presentation skills with the ability to respond to questions from internal and external customers
  • Excellent human relations skills
  • Highly self motivated and flexible
  • Capable of working under pressure and with short completion time on projects
  • Excellent project management skills with the ability to multitask
  • Strong understanding of the human resources body of knowledge
  • Computer experience
  • Demands of a typical office position
  • Flexible hours to meet customer/project demands

Responsibilities

  • Administer payroll programs according to company policies and guidelines
  • Work with production leadership to ensure proper staffing levels are maintained. Work with external agencies when needed. Conduct recruiting activities to support production requirements
  • Ensure internal promotion process is followed according to company policies and completed in timely manner
  • Maintain job descriptions and associate handbook to current levels
  • Maintain high profile with all associates to build positive relationships, ensuring associate concerns are addressed in a timely manner. Provides a resource to floor associates and leadership team in employee relations issues.
  • Follow and support MBCI’s and Magna’s operating principles
  • Provide necessary support to Human Resources Manager and serves as backup in the manager’s absence
  • Assist in the maintenance of the human resources associate information databases
  • Perform other duties as assigned
